Thessaloniki: A Vibrant Tapestry of History and Culture

Thessaloniki, Greece's second-largest city, is a vibrant metropolis steeped in a rich and multifaceted history. Founded in 315 BC by Cassander, it has been a crossroads of civilizations throughout the centuries, leaving behind a captivating legacy of architectural wonders, archaeological treasures, and cultural traditions.

Must-Visit Historical Sites:

  • White Tower: An iconic landmark of Thessaloniki, this 15th-century Ottoman fortress offers panoramic city views.
  • Arch of Galerius and Rotunda: Admire the grandeur of Roman architecture at this well-preserved triumphal arch and cylindrical building.
  • Hagia Sophia: Explore the magnificent Byzantine basilica, renowned for its exquisite mosaics and intricate frescoes.
  • Museum of Byzantine Culture: Journey through centuries of Byzantine art and history in this world-class museum.

Mount Athos: A Sacred Haven for Orthodox Monasticism

Just a short ferry ride from Thessaloniki lies Mount Athos, an autonomous monastic republic that has been a spiritual haven for over 1,000 years. This sacred peninsula is home to 20 Eastern Orthodox monasteries, each with its own unique history and architectural splendor.

Pilgrimage to the Holy Mountain:

  • Obtain a special permit: All visitors to Mount Athos, except for female pilgrims, require a special permit called a diamonitirion.
  • Dress appropriately: Respect the monastic traditions by dressing modestly with long pants or skirts and covered shoulders.
  • Observe silence and tranquility: Mount Athos is a place of prayer and contemplation, so maintain silence and avoid loud noises or disruptive behavior.
  • Stay in designated areas: Pilgrims can stay in guesthouses or hostels within the monasteries or in nearby villages.

Explore the Enchanting Monasteries:

  • Monastery of Great Lavra: Visit the oldest and most important monastery on Mount Athos, founded in the 10th century.
  • Monastery of Vatopedi: Admire the stunning Byzantine architecture and marvel at the monastery's collection of sacred relics.
  • Monastery of Iviron: Discover the rich history and artistic treasures of this Georgian monastery, including the miraculous icon of the Virgin Mary.
  • Monastery of Xeropotamou: Explore the largest monastery on Mount Athos, known for its impressive library and collection of Byzantine manuscripts.
